Sri Lanka August annual inflation eases to 7pc

COLOMBO : Sri Lanka 's annual inflation slowed to a lower-than-expected 7.0 percent in August from a year earlier, down

Annual average inflation, measured by a 12-month moving average, accelerated to 7.1 percent this month, its highest in the new index, from 7.0 percent in July. A Reuters poll by 14 analysts had expected annual inflation to stabilise at 7.5 percent and the annual average to hit 7.2 percent.

The Department of Census and Statistics in June introduced the new index based on a 2006/2007 survey, replacing an earlier one that had 2002 as a base year.
